“…Most studies agree that spring phenophases (i.e., flowering, leaf-out and bud opening) tend to start earlier in highly urbanised areas (Jia et al, 2021;Li et al, 2019;Meng et al, 2020;Ren et al, 2018;Wohlfahrt et al, 2019;Yang et al, 2020). The opposite trendi.e., delay in spring phenophases with urbanisationhas occasionally been reported (Galán Díaz et al, 2023;Zhang et al, 2022), which may indicate that some plant species do not adequately meet their chilling requirements due to rising autumn and winter temperatures (Inouye, 2022;Piao et al, 2023;Yu et al, 2010). Most studies also report delays in autumn phenophases (e.g., leaf senescence) caused by urbanisation (Ren et al, 2018;Wohlfahrt et al, 2019;Yang et al, 2020).…”

“…For instance, annual plants, early-flowering species and lowergrowing perennials with a higher specific leaf area show the greatest advances in their spring phenophases (Inouye, 2022;Li et al, 2019;Neil and Wu, 2006). In addition, it has been reported that deciduous and evergreen species might show contrasting phenological responses to urbanisation; hence leaf longevity also plays an important role (Galán Díaz et al, 2023;Zhang et al, 2022). On the other hand, regional climate affects the daily and seasonal relationship between urbanisation intensity and land surface temperatures (Sismanidis et al, 2022;Wienert and Kuttler, 2005).…”
